Notes for JESSE
JAMES
CUNNINGHAM:
Records obtained from the Tennessee State archives
show Jesse as marrying Mary A .E. Williams on November 30, 1838. The
signature on the marriage certificate and the marriage bond are an exact match
to signatures on probate records and land titles showing his signature. His first born
was Nancy Emaline born June 3, 1840, in Moulton, Lauderdale County, Alabama.
Nancy married Wiley C. Nanney in Itawamba Mississippi. Information obtained from
Ronney Nanney of Cedar Hill, Texas states that Nancy's mother was named "Easter", he
does not know if this was a given name or a surname. I am going under the
assumption that the "E" initial in Mary Williams name is Easter.
Nanney believes that Nancy's mother died while Nancy was very Young, In
this case, Jesse married again, and
to Mary C. Hurley. The 1870 census shows Mary C. as being born in Alabama.
Jesse James is found in
the 1840 and 1850 Alabama Census, and in Mississippi census in 1860. The birth
dates, and birth places of his children indicate that he moved to Mississippi
about 1852 or 53.
Jesse James Cunningham entered the
Confederate Army of America in 1861, Company K, 1st Regiment, Mississippi
Volunteers, known as Mississippi Yankee Hunters. Most of the men in this
division were from Itawamba County, they were organized in Corinth, Ms. They
were in the battle of Hopkinsville Kentucky, November 11, 1861.They were at
Bowling Green and Columbia, Kentucky October 8, 1861, they
were captured in the battle of Ft. Danielson, Feb. 16,1862, and held at
Ft. Morton, Indianapolis, Indiana until August of that year . He was captured
again at the battle of Port Hudson, Louisiana on July 9, 1863 and released on
July 13, 1863. Information taken from Confederate Army records, roll #20 sheet
7, and roll # 188, sheet 10. He later joined Featherstones Brigade and took part
in the Georgia campaign and later in the battles of Franklin and Nashville under
General Hood in December of 1864.

Notes for WALTER
NEALON
CUNNINGHAM:
Walter always had a
smile on his face and had a chuckle for everyone. He was easy to know and easy
to like, and the firstborn child of Jesse H. Cunningham and Effie A. Gilliam. He
learned farming and other skills from his dad, and farmed for awhile in his
younger days near Lamesa, Texas. He soon followed the rest of the family to
Abilene during the dust bowl, and bought a filling station at fifth and Hickory
St. in Abilene. This proved to be an unprofitable business, and he went into
carpentry for awhile.
In about 1941 he moved
his family to Ft. Worth, Texas when he became a journeyman sheet metal worker in
the defense industry in an aircraft plant. I*n the mid forties he moved his
family to Albuquerque, New Mexico for a few years before moving to La Puente,
California where he remained for the rest of his life.
He died in June 1980 of
colon cancer.

Notes for DOROTHY
LORENE
YOUNG:
Dorothy Lorene died in
an automobile accident near Ballinger, a small town a few miles northeast of San
Angelo, Texas on a sunny July afternoon. She was driving, in the car with her
was her younger sister, Burta Lee (Ginger) Caldwell, who was critically injured.
Ginger spent several weeks in intensive care at a San Angelo hospital.
Dorothy's funeral was
held at Elliott-Hamil Funeral Home in Abilene. Elliott's has buried many
Cunningham's over the years. She is buried in Cedar Hill Cemetery in block 115,
lot 5, space 5, not far from her mother and dad, Alburtice T. Young and Minnie
Lee Holley, as well as many other relatives and in laws. She is buried next to a
favorite nephew, Lowell Petifils who was buried there in May of 1998.
After her divorce from
Marvin Cunningham during the second world war, she joined the Women Ordinance
Workers. After her basic training in Cisco , Texas she was sent to Ft. Worth,
Texas and worked in an aircraft factory for awhile. She was later transferred to
Barksdale Air Force Base in Shreveport, Louisiana, then to Camp Barkley, Texas
near Abilene. She was transferred once more to Ft. Carson, Colorado near
Colorado Springs, where she met and married her second husband, Norman Karas.
They later moved to Pueblo, divorced, and she moved with her children Tony,
Holly and Robin to Abilene, where she died.

Notes for KENNETH
RAY CUNNINGHAM:
Ken was born in
Justiceburg, Texas, a three building town southeast of Post, Texas in Garza
County, on a dry land cotton farm during the dust bowl and the great depression.
The family soon moved to Elmdale where the family opened a gas station and
country store on old US Hiway 80. Elmdale is a few miles east of Abilene, Texas.
Ken joined the Naval
Reserve in 1949, then re-enlisted for a full four year term in 1951. While in
the navy he trained at Coronado Amphibious Base near San Diego in UDT-Seal Unit,
team 11. Among the various ships he served on were the heavy cruiser CA-75 USS
Helena, the USS Geo. Clymer, the USS Henrico, the USS Talladega, and the USS
Renville. He served on the staff of Commodore Fritz Gliem.
After leaving the navy,
he tried his hand in the egg business, worked at the CFI as a steelworker,
worked at sales for several years in the wholesale paper business, as a
marketing and management consultant before entering teaching.
He attended school at
Abilene High School in Texas, Pueblo Jr. College, Red Rocks College, Univ. Of
Northern Colo., Colo. State Univ. and the University of Minnesota. He retired in
1991.
Taught at Red Rocks
College, Metropolitan State College, Univ. of Colo. At Denver, Aurora Community
College and Arapahoe Community College.
